Physical Strength and Design of Secure Door Locks
At the most basic level, the effectiveness of secure door locks lies in their physical strength and design. High-quality locks, such as those offered by DESLOC, incorporate robust materials and sophisticated locking mechanisms that resist forced entry methods like lock picking, drilling, or kicking. A well-constructed lock cylinder, reinforced strike plates features significantly increase the time and effort required for an intruder to gain access, often deterring attempts altogether.

The Role of Smart Technology in Enhancing Security
Beyond physical strength, security door locks for homes increasingly incorporate smart technologies that elevate protection levels. Smart locks like the DESLOC B200L Fingerprint Smart Lock offer advanced functionalities such as fingerprint recognition, Bluetooth connectivity, and remote control via the TTLock app(Note: Remote control can be achieved by upgrading the G2 gateway, which needs to be purchased separately). These features allow homeowners to manage access in real-time, monitor entry logs, and generate temporary access codes for guests or service personnel, which enhances security by limiting unauthorized or unmonitored entry.
The anti-peeping PIN code protection and auto-lock functions reduce vulnerabilities by preventing password theft and ensuring doors are never unintentionally left unlocked.
